VARIETAL REACTION AND CHEMICAL CONTROL OF CUCUMBER POWDERY MILDEW IN EGYPT
Plant Pathology Research institute, Agricultural Research Centre, Giza, Egypt
Abstract
The reaction of four cucumber cultivars aganist Erysiphe cichoracearum DC., the causal pathogen of powdery mildew revealed that Beit Alpha cultivar was highly susceptible, while Amira was moderately susceptible. On the other hand, Medina was moderatley resistant while Sweet crunsh showed high resistance. Fungicidal efficiency showed that karathane 48%, Anvil, Alto 100, Topas 100 and Afugan were the most effective fungicides against powdery mildew of cucumber while flowable sulphur, Benlate, Dorado and Sumi-eight were the least effective fungicides. Kema-Z and Bayfidan showed the lowest effect.
